Why Pinstriping Is Gaining Popularity Among Car Enthusiasts
Globally, pinstriping is becoming more and more popular among automobile enthusiasts as a detailed and complex art form. Using this custom detailing technique, a vehicle’s surface is painted or taped with thin lines of paint to add aesthetic appeal and personalize the look. Pinstriping is making a comeback because it appeals to nostalgia, artistic sensibilities, and the need for uniqueness. The reasons behind the growing fascination in the automotive community with pinstriping are examined below.
Customization’s Allure
The desire for customization is one of the primary factors contributing to the popularity of pinstriping. Automobile enthusiasts look for ways to distinguish their cars in a market full of mass-produced vehicles. Through the application of pinstriping, an ordinary vehicle can be transformed into a work of art, reflecting the owner’s personality and sense of style.
A Tribute to Custom
Reminiscent of the early days of hot rodding and custom cars, pinstriping evokes nostalgia and appreciation for the artistry of bygone eras. Pinstriping honors the legends of custom car culture by fusing the old and the new, fostering a sense of continuity and legacy.
Displaying Craftsmanship
Pinstriping goes beyond personalization; it is an exhibition of artistic ability. In the automotive world, pinstriping is a highly regarded art form because it requires a high level of expertise and creativity to execute flawlessly. The skill required to create complex designs is appreciated by enthusiasts.
Improving the Look of Vehicles
Pinstriping can greatly improve a vehicle’s appearance by emphasizing its features and contours, increasing its perceived value and distinctiveness. It also creates fine lines and patterns. Pinstriping gives a vehicle’s appearance depth and dimension, whether it is subtle or bold.

Social Media’s Effect
Social media has given artists a platform to share their work and connect with a worldwide audience, which has been instrumental in the resurgence of pinstriping. Fans have the ability to learn new techniques, keep up with current events and trends, and follow their favorite pinstriper artists.
Availability and Do-It-Yourself Culture
The DIY culture in the automotive community has also contributed to the popularity of pinstriping by making the technique more approachable for enthusiasts. The abundance of resources such as tutorials, tools, and materials that enable experimentation with various designs and techniques further fuels the enthusiasm of pinstriping enthusiasts.
